本文共 396 字,大约阅读时间需要 1 分钟。
利用 crushmap , 把不同的 osd 存放到不同的分组中
不同的 ceph pool 独立使用到不同的 crushmap 分组 (即使用不同的 osd 磁盘) 从物理上隔离了不同的 pool 数据读写 IO
hostA | hostB | hostC | 备注 |
osd.0 | osd.4 | osd.8 | 把 osd0 ~ osd.11 划分到 root=default 根中只供 volumes pool 调用 |
osd.1 | osd.5 | osd.9 | |
osd.2 | osd.6 | osd.10 | |
osd.3 | osd.7 | osd.11 | |
osd.12 | osd.14 | osd.16 | 把 osd14 ~ osd.17 划分到 root=noah 根中只供 noah pool 调用 |
osd.13 | osd.15 | osd.17 | |
ceph osd cr
转载地址:http://msnni.baihongyu.com/